Buying Guide for Matching Transformer for TV Antenna
Understanding What a Matching Transformer Is
When I first set up my TV antenna, I realized the importance of a matching transformer. It’s a small device that helps match the impedance between my antenna and the TV or receiver. This matching is crucial because it minimizes signal loss and improves picture quality. Without the right transformer, my signal was weak and prone to interference.
Why Do I Need a Matching Transformer?
I needed a matching transformer because my antenna’s impedance didn’t match my TV’s input. Most antennas are designed with 300-ohm output, while many TVs accept 75-ohm input. The transformer bridges this gap, ensuring the signal flows efficiently. If you want better reception and fewer disruptions, this device is essential.
Key Factors to Consider When Buying
When I was shopping, I focused on a few important aspects:
- Impedance Ratio: The most common is 300-ohm to 75-ohm. Make sure the transformer matches your antenna’s and TV’s impedance to avoid signal loss.
- Frequency Range: My antenna receives signals across various frequencies, so I chose a transformer that supports the entire range of TV channels.
- Build Quality: A well-built transformer with good shielding reduces interference from other electronics.
- Connector Type: I checked if the transformer had the right connectors for my setup—often screw terminals on one side and an F-type connector on the other.
- Size and Installation: Since I installed mine indoors, I preferred a compact and easy-to-mount model.
Installation Tips From My Experience
Installing the matching transformer was straightforward. I connected the 300-ohm side to my antenna’s twin-lead cable and the 75-ohm side to the coaxial cable going to my TV. I made sure the connections were secure and kept the transformer away from sources of electrical noise. Proper installation made a noticeable difference in signal quality.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
In my early attempts, I made a few mistakes:
- Using a transformer with the wrong impedance ratio, which worsened the signal.
- Ignoring the frequency range, leading to poor reception on certain channels.
- Placing the transformer near power supplies or other electronics that caused interference.
Avoiding these helped me get the best performance out of my antenna system.
